Poll `/fhir/$export-status/` to check progress, and send a DELETE request to cancel. + +## Consent-based patient filtering + +{% hint style="info" %} +Available since version 2605. +{% endhint %} + +Group-level export can filter patients based on FHIR [Consent](https://hl7.org/fhir/r4/consent.html) resources. This enables workflows where patient data sharing requires explicit agreement (opt-in) or where patients can refuse sharing (opt-out) — for example, [Da Vinci PDex](https://hl7.org/fhir/us/davinci-pdex/STU2.1/) payer-to-payer exchange and provider access. + +| Parameter | Type | Cardinality | Description | +| -------------------------------- | ------ | ----------- | -------------------------------------------------------------------------------------- | +| `consentStrategy` | `code` | 0..1 | `opt-in` or `opt-out`. Determines how consents affect patient inclusion. | +| `consentProfile` | `uri` | 0..1 | StructureDefinition URL to filter consents by `meta.profile`. Omit to match any Consent.| +| `organizationIdentifierSystem` | `uri` | 0..1 | Which `Organization.identifier.system` to use for actor matching (opt-in only). | + +{% hint style="warning" %} +For `opt-in`, both `organizationIdentifierSystem` and a JWT token with `extensions.hl7-b2b.organization_id` are required. Missing either returns **422**. +{% endhint %} + +### Consent resource requirements + +Consent resources must have: + +- `status` = `active` +- `provision.type` = `permit` (for opt-in) or `deny` (for opt-out) +- `provision.period` with `start` and `end` covering the current date +- `meta.profile` matching `consentProfile` (if specified) + +For **opt-in**, the Consent must also have `provision.actor` entries with: + +- An actor with `role.coding[0].code` = `performer` referencing the **source** Organization (the requesting payer) +- An actor with `role.coding[0].code` = `IRCP` referencing the **recipient** Organization (resolved from `Group.managingEntity`) + +Both organizations are matched by their `identifier` where `system` equals `organizationIdentifierSystem`. + +### Opt-out strategy + +All group members are included by default. Members are excluded only if they have an active Consent with `provision.type = "deny"` matching the specified profile and a valid period covering the current date. + +{% tabs %} +{% tab title="GET" %} +```http +GET /fhir/Group/grp-1/$export?_type=Patient&consentStrategy=opt-out&consentProfile=http://hl7.org/fhir/us/davinci-pdex/StructureDefinition/pdex-provider-consent +``` +{% endtab %} + +{% tab title="POST" %} +```json +{ + "resourceType": "Parameters", + "parameter": [ + { "name": "_type", "valueString": "Patient" }, + { "name": "consentStrategy", "valueCode": "opt-out" }, + { "name": "consentProfile", "valueUri": "http://hl7.org/fhir/us/davinci-pdex/StructureDefinition/pdex-provider-consent" } + ] +} +``` +{% endtab %} +{% endtabs %} + +### Opt-in strategy + +No members are included by default. Members are included only if they have an active Consent with `provision.type = "permit"`, matching source and recipient organization actors, and a valid period. + +The **source organization** is identified from the JWT access token's [UDAP B2B Authorization Extension](https://build.fhir.org/ig/HL7/fhir-udap-security-ig/branches/master/b2b.html) (`extensions.hl7-b2b.organization_id`). The **recipient organization** is resolved from `Group.managingEntity`, using the `organizationIdentifierSystem` to select the correct identifier. + +{% tabs %} +{% tab title="GET" %} +```http +GET /fhir/Group/grp-1/$export?_type=Patient&consentStrategy=opt-in&consentProfile=http://hl7.org/fhir/us/davinci-hrex/StructureDefinition/hrex-consent&organizationIdentifierSystem=urn:oid:2.16.840.1.113883.4.4 +``` +{% endtab %} + +{% tab title="POST" %} +```json +{ + "resourceType": "Parameters", + "parameter": [ + { "name": "_type", "valueString": "Patient" }, + { "name": "consentStrategy", "valueCode": "opt-in" }, + { "name": "consentProfile", "valueUri": "http://hl7.org/fhir/us/davinci-hrex/StructureDefinition/hrex-consent" }, + { "name": "organizationIdentifierSystem", "valueUri": "urn:oid:2.16.840.1.113883.4.4" } + ] +} +``` +{% endtab %} +{% endtabs %} + +### UDAP B2B token configuration + +For opt-in workflows, the requesting client must present a **JWT** access token containing the B2B extension. The Client must be configured with `token_format: "jwt"` in the `client_credentials` auth settings — opaque tokens do not carry B2B claims. + +Add the `client-hl7B2b` extension to your Client resource: + +```json +{ + "resourceType": "Client", + "id": "payer-client", + "grant_types": ["client_credentials"], + "auth": { + "client_credentials": { + "token_format": "jwt" + } + }, + "extension": [ + { + "url": "http://health-samurai.io/fhir/core/StructureDefinition/client-hl7B2b", + "extension": [ + { + "url": "organization", + "valueReference": { "reference": "Organization/my-org" } + }, + { + "url": "organizationIdentifierSystem", + "valueUri": "urn:oid:2.16.840.1.113883.4.4" + }, + { + "url": "purposeOfUse", + "valueCoding": { + "system": "http://terminology.hl7.org/CodeSystem/v3-ActReason", + "code": "HPAYMT" + } + } + ] + } + ] +} +``` + +When this extension is present, `/auth/token` includes the [UDAP B2B Authorization Extension](https://build.fhir.org/ig/HL7/fhir-udap-security-ig/branches/master/b2b.html) in the JWT: + +```json +{ + "extensions": { + "hl7-b2b": { + "version": "1", + "organization_id": "urn:oid:2.16.840.1.113883.4.4#12-3456789", + "organization_name": "My Organization", + "purpose_of_use": ["http://terminology.hl7.org/CodeSystem/v3-ActReason#HPAYMT"] + } + } +} +``` + +The `organization_id` is resolved from the referenced Organization's identifier where `system` matches `organizationIdentifierSystem`. + +## Lenient patient handling + +{% hint style="info" %} +Available since version 2605. +{% endhint %} + +By default, `$export` returns **422** when a `patient` reference points to a non-existent Patient or a Patient that is not a member of the specified Group. This follows the base [FHIR Bulk Data Export](https://hl7.org/fhir/uv/bulkdata/export.html) specification. + +The [Da Vinci `$davinci-data-export`](http://hl7.org/fhir/us/davinci-atr/OperationDefinition-davinci-data-export.html) specification requires different behavior: invalid patient references should be silently ignored, and the export should proceed with valid ones. + +Set `onPatientError=ignore` to enable this behavior: + +| `onPatientError` | Behavior | +| ---------------- | -------- | +| `fail` (default) | Abort with **422** if any patient reference is invalid or not a group member. | +| `ignore` | Drop invalid references. Proceed with valid ones. Report each dropped patient as an OperationOutcome warning in the export status `error[]` array. | + +When all requested patients are invalid, the server returns an immediate **200** with an empty `output[]` and warnings in `error[]` — no async export is started. + +{% tabs %} +{% tab title="POST" %} +```json +{ + "resourceType": "Parameters", + "parameter": [ + { "name": "_type", "valueString": "Patient" }, + { "name": "onPatientError", "valueCode": "ignore" }, + { "name": "patient", "valueReference": { "reference": "Patient/valid-member" } }, + { "name": "patient", "valueReference": { "reference": "Patient/non-existent" } } + ] +} +``` +{% endtab %} + +{% tab title="Export status error[]" %} +```json +{ + "status": "completed", + "output": [ + { "type": "Patient", "url": "https://storage/...", "count": 1 } + ], + "error": [ + { "type": "OperationOutcome", + "url": "urn:warning:Patient/non-existent ignored: not found or not a member of the group" } + ] +} +``` +{% endtab %} +{% endtabs %}
